What Does BSF Mean?

“BSF” most commonly stands for “Best Friend.”
Yes, it’s that simple.
People use “BSF” as a short and quick way to refer to someone they are very close to. It’s similar to saying:
- Bestie
- BFF (Best Friend Forever)
- Close friend
So if someone texts:
“That’s my BSF 💕”
They are saying:
“That’s my best friend.”

Does BSF Ever Mean Something Else?
Yes—but rarely in everyday texting.
While “BSF” usually means “Best Friend,” it can have other meanings in different contexts. However, these are less common in social media conversations.
Here are a few alternative meanings:
1. Border Security Force
In official or government-related discussions, “BSF” refers to a security organization in some countries.
But this meaning is not used in casual texting.
2. Other Niche Uses
In certain industries or technical discussions, “BSF” might stand for different things. But again, these meanings are not relevant in everyday chats.
Important Tip
If you see “BSF” in a casual conversation, it almost always means best friend.
Context is key.
BSF vs BFF: What’s the Difference?
Many people confuse “BSF” with “BFF,” so let’s clear it up.
BFF
Means: Best Friend Forever
Tone: Slightly more emotional or long-term
BSF
Means: Best Friend
Tone: More casual and modern
Which One Do People Use More Today?
“BSF” is more popular among younger users, especially on platforms like TikTok and Snapchat.
“BFF” still exists but feels a bit older or more traditional.
